Commit-ID: 6f98f92971e9acd820accf936e38101c2fc5d34b Gitweb: http://git.kernel.org/tip/6f98f92971e9acd820accf936e38101c2fc5d34b Author: Peter Zijlstra <a.p.zijlstra@xxxxxxxxx> AuthorDate: Mon, 19 Mar 2012 18:54:52 +0100 Committer: Ingo Molnar <mingo@xxxxxxxxxx> CommitDate: Wed, 26 Sep 2012 11:48:31 +0200 mm/mpol: Make MPOL_LOCAL a real policy Make MPOL_LOCAL a real and exposed policy such that applications that relied on the previous default behaviour can explicitly request it.
